Not the craziest, but last night in the U-20s, a Portuguese player named Mano was getting sent off for shoving down an opposing player, and one of his teammates, Zequinha, walked over and ripped the red card out of the referee's hand. So, the player that stole the red card gets sent off as well, and then starts crying his eyes out.

     

    I've never seen anything like that.
